<a href=showthread.php?s=&postid=14729944#post14729944 target=_blank>Originally posted</a> by Meitzler
What are the pros and cons of the Icecap retrofits, verse tek 5, verses sunblaze for a 20" deep tank? Or is the ATI a must.

Depends what you want to raise. Unless you want an acro garden on the sand you don't need to overdrive or even a ATI fixture. A Tek light would allow you to grow anything properly placed. The Ice Cap HO retro would allow you to have stonies in most of the tank. Sunblaze would be OK for Acros up high.
 
<a href=showthread.php?s=&postid=14730493#post14730493 target=_blank>Originally posted</a> by kurtkob
Hi, I´ve got a question...My tank is 32g and I´ve just change my ATI SUNPOWER 4x24W for the 6x39W one... it means changing from 96W to 234w... Could I have any problem with my corals??? is it to much light??? Now I´m using 3 aquablue special and 3 blue plus... is it correct??? any suggestion for a SPS tank??please???

PD: sorry for my english... :/

You might want to decrease your photo period. I would still run dusk/dawn 10 to 12 hours a day but decrease the other lights down to maybe 4 hours and work you way back up from there. Just watch your animals to see if they are stressed/ Take out one aquablue lamp and replace it with the ATI Pro Color.
